Frequently Asked Questions about McLean
How much are Studio apartments in McLean?
There are currently 80 Studio Apartments in McLean with rent ranges from $955 to $4,325 with an average price of $1,986.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om McLean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in McLean ranges from $1,199 to $9,852 with an average monthly rent of $2,510.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in McLean c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in McLean range from $2,000 to $13,803.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,466.
How expensive are McLean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 51 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in McLean on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,392 to $10,619 - averaging $4,279 for the location.
